Addresses, phone numbers, and business hours for FedEx Drop Offs in Lynnwood, WA.
FedEx Drop Off Lynnwood WA 1515 164th St SW 98087
FedEx Drop Off Lynnwood WA 3400 188th Street Southwest 98037
FedEx Drop Off Lynnwood WA 3500 188th St SW 98037
FedEx Drop Off Lynnwood WA 3611 196th Street Southwest 98036
FedEx Drop Off Lynnwood WA 4211 200th Street Southwest 98036